Red Rose Transit Authority Queen Street Parking Structure - Lancaster, Pennsylvania For the Red Rose Transit Authority, TimHaahs is providing prime design services for the 450-space Queen Street parking structure in historic downtown Lancaster. TimHaahs is providing architectural, engineering, and planning services for the mixed-use structure, which will include space at grade for retail uses, as well as provisions for future development on top of the garage. Coordinating with the Red Rose Transit Authority, as well as the Lancaster Museum of Art, TimHaahs is incorporating the new parking structure into the historic atmosphere of the downtown area. The structure will serve as an attractive complement to the museum. The facility will also include a pedestrian connection from the garage to the museum to provide direct access for museum visitors. For the future development, TimHaahs will provide structural engineering for the ten story residential tower. This tower will also incorporate a green roof. ![]()
